What are the most common challenges in maintaining the structural integrity of kinetic metal sculptures?

Kinetic metal sculptures, celebrated for their dynamic movement and artistic brilliance, face unique challenges in maintaining structural integrity. One primary issue is material fatigue caused by constant motion, which can weaken joints and connections over time. Environmental factors like wind, rain, and temperature fluctuations further exacerbate wear, leading to corrosion or warping. Additionally, the balance between aesthetic design and mechanical durability often complicates maintenance, as intricate moving parts require precise alignment. Proper lubrication and regular inspections are essential, yet overlooked, leading to premature failure. Lastly, the choice of metals—some prone to rust or brittleness—can dictate longevity, making material selection a critical yet often underestimated factor. Addressing these challenges ensures these captivating artworks endure for generations.
